Affordable running shoes have evolved, incorporating technologies from high-end models like responsive foams and breathable uppers. Brands trickle down innovations to entry-level lines, ensuring you get quality without the premium price tag. Lab tests show many under-$100 options match pricier rivals in flexibility, shock absorption, and longevity. Ideal for daily training, walking, or casual runs, they reduce injury risk with proper cushioning and support. However, they may wear faster on high-mileage use, so rotate pairs if running over 20 miles weekly.
How We Selected the Best Budget Running Shoes
Our selections are based on comprehensive reviews from running coaches, lab analyses, and real-world testing. We prioritized shoes under $100 (or discounted to that range), focusing on neutral support for most runners, road/trail versatility, weight under 11 oz, and heel drops of 8-10mm for natural stride. Key metrics included midsole softness, outsole durability, breathability, and value. Sources tested thousands of miles, measuring wear resistance and energy return. We excluded overly basic models lacking cushioning.

Popular Shoe with Older Model Discount – Nike Pegasus
The
Nike Pegasus
is a running staple, blending style, lightweight breathability, and Zoom Air cushioning in forefoot and heel. Extra padding at tongue and collar boosts comfort for long runs. New models retail at $140, but older versions or select colors dip under $100 at Dick’s Sporting Goods. Great for neutral road runners (trail version available). Weight: 10.4 oz men’s, 8.6 oz women’s. Heel drop: 10mm.- Pros: Versatile for training/casual use, responsive cushioning, durable outsole.
- Cons: Premium price for newest model; seek sales.
- Best for: Daily miles, beginners to intermediates.
Best Budget Entry-Level Run/Walk Shoe – Brooks Revel
Perfect for new runners or walkers, the
Brooks Revel
(v8 or similar) offers cushioned midsole for shock absorption at $100. Sleek, breathable upper suits road to light trails. Lightweight at 8.9 oz men’s, 8.2 oz women’s (10mm drop). Available at Brooksrunning.com or Zappos.- Pros: Affordable, versatile for errands post-run, softer midsole.
- Cons: Less responsive than elite trainers.
- Best for: Beginners, casual fitness.
Best Budget Stability Running Shoe – Brooks Launch
For mild stability needs, the
Brooks Launch
provides lightweight comfort (7.7 oz men’s, 7.1 oz women’s; 8mm drop) at $120, with older models under $100. Cushioned midsole eases joint strain on roads.- Pros: Effortless movement, durable, value-packed.
- Cons: Neutral bias may not suit severe overpronators.
- Best for: Road training, tempo runs.
Best Budget Stylish Running Comfort – New Balance Fresh Foam Arishi
Featuring Fresh Foam X midsole (same as premium 1080), this
New Balance
shoe delivers plush rides for road/treadmill at $60-$85 on Amazon. 10.2 oz men’s, 9 oz women’s; 10mm drop. Neutral support.- Pros: Superior cushioning, stylish, deep discounts.
- Cons: Heavier than racers.
- Best for: Walking, daily training.

How to Find the Best Deals on Running Shoes
Save more with these proven strategies:
- Shop Older Models: Last-gen shoes like Pegasus 40 drop 30-50%.
- Sign Up for Newsletters: Brands email exclusive codes.
- Running Retailers: Running Warehouse, Zappos for deep discounts.
- Price Trackers: Tools like CamelCamelCamel monitor Amazon drops.
- Unpopular Colors: Blues/greens often cheaper.
- Loyalty Programs: Nike Members, Brooks VIP for points/perks.
Running Shoe Buying Guide
Select based on foot type: Neutral for most; stability for overpronators. Measure at stores for fit—1 thumb width space in toebox. Replace every 300-500 miles. Consider stack height (28-35mm for cushion) and breathability for hot runs. Gait analysis at specialty shops helps.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: Can budget shoes prevent injuries?
A: Yes, with proper cushioning and fit, they reduce impact like pricier options. Pair with strength training.
Q: What’s the best cheap shoe for beginners?
A: Brooks Revel—cushioned, versatile for run/walk.
Q: How often should I buy new running shoes?
A: Every 300-500 miles or when cushion compresses.
Q: Are trail versions budget-friendly?
A: Yes, like Pegasus Trail or Saucony Excursion under $100 on sale.
Q: Wide feet? Best budget pick?
A: Anta PG7 or NB 680 v8 with wide toebox.
